PTC® Expands Business with Visteon and Delivers Mathcad® for Engineering Calculations

Engineering Calculation Tool Adds Value to Existing Pro/ENGINEER® Implementation

NEEDHAM, MA. – July 30, 2007 - PTC (Nasdaq: PMTC), the Product Development Company®, today announced that Visteon Corporation (NYSE: VC), a leading global automotive supplier, is using Mathcad to create and document the engineering calculations and mathematical models used in the design of automotive electronics.

With Mathcad, users can develop mathematical models used to verify that designs will meet customer requirements over varying production and environmental conditions. Mathcad worksheets are designed to communicate analysis results to other interested parties throughout the design process.

Because the worksheets are reusable, they can be used as a starting point for similar designs, which can improve productivity and enhance analysis capabilities.

Mathcad’s standards-based XML architecture enables organizations to extend its capability beyond just engineering calculations. Its open-engineering data model easily integrates to other engineering applications and creates an auditable trail of documented calculations that simplify compliance reporting, verification and troubleshooting initiatives.

Mathcad enables organizations to create, automate, document and reuse engineering calculations early in the product development process in order to determine the critical dimensions and parameters used to create the CAD model. By calculating the parameters required and predicting the performance of the design early in the process, instead of guessing key dimensions and parameters, product designers can more rapidly produce optimized designs. Mathcad is ideal for knowledge capture of engineering calculations and gives engineers the ability to reuse engineering-driven analyses throughout the design process that can save time, streamline design processes and reduce costs associated with rework.
